To make a finishing choice on which processor is better, you should also consider the generation of its core. The newer the processor generation, the better its performance in games and benchmarks, as well as its energy efficiency. In this case the Core i9-13900HK is more energy efficient than the Core i9-10900KF as it consumes less power: 45W vs. 125W. Power consumption is especially important for laptops. Also, when choosing a processor cooling system, you must know its TDP. It is necessary to calculate so that the TDP data specified in the cooler specification is greater than the TDP of the compared processor.

For example you want to use the processor not only for gaming, but also for video editing or video rendering, machine learning, streaming, programming, then first of all you need to pay attention to the performance in multi-threaded mode. In this mode, to reach maximum performance, the processor turns on all threads and cores that it has. You will learn this data from the benchmark tables below. Before using the data from these tests, be sure to check whether the software you are going to use on your computer supports multi-threaded mode. Because there are still many programs that use only one core to run, and all the benefit of multi-core mode are unused.

Intel Core i9-13900HK Intel Core i9-10900KF
Announcement dateNovember 12, 2022April 01, 2020
TypeLaptopDesktop
SocketFCBGA1744FCLGA1200
Core nameRaptor LakeComet Lake
Architecturex86x86
Generation1310
Turbo Frequency5.2 MHz5.3 MHz
Frequency2.8 MHz3.7 MHz
Cores1410
Threads2020
Bus rate16 GT/s8 GT/s
Bit6464
Lithography7 nm14 nm
Transistors count14200 millions9200 millions
Power consumption (TDP)45 W125 W
Memory typeUp to DDR5 5600 MT/s Up to DDR4 3200 MT/sDDR4-2933
Max. Memory128 Gb128 Gb
Memory Frequency6500
Memory bandwidth89.6 GB/s45.8 GB/s
L1 cache2 MB
L2 cache8 MB
L3 cache32 MB20 MB
OverclockingNoNo
Supports ECCYesNo
Part number
In this comparison block, you should pay attention to the differences in clock speed and the number of cores. Here Core i9-10900KF is 24% better than Core i9-13900HK in terms of CPU frequency. Another difference is that Core i9-13900HK has 4 more core than Core i9-10900KF. Also keep in mind that high CPU frequency affects battery life through power consumption (relevant for laptops).
